Block

#21,429,883
Block Number
21,429,883 @ 04/11/2025, 01:54:20
Status
Finalized
ID
0x0146fe7bfccbcd2b3616356cfe724df805c888e70a7d0f0e53d4aded6acf4454
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
194,284,097 (+14)
Rewards
0.00 VTHO